On today’s show, I had a chat with my sister, Priscilla Shirer. Priscilla has a role in an upcoming film, Overcomer, produced by the Kendrick Brothers, which will debut on August 23, 2019. She has also just released a new book, Radiant, and a new Bible study, Defined. Overcomer, Radiant, and Defined all center on the theme of identity. Priscilla shared these words about identity in her new book:
“The culture will try to DEFINE YOU, your past may try to LABEL YOU, the enemy will seek to DECEIVE YOU, but no one has the authority to GIVE YOU YOUR NAME—your true identity—except your Father.”
It’s important not to allow our value to be wrapped up in worldly, temporal things, but instead to have it firmly rooted in the unchanging Words God has spoken over our lives. When circumstances arise that make us question our true identity, we must renew our minds in the Word and boldly and courageously declare its truths. When we know who we truly are and walk in the light of it, it will give us confidence in Him and His ability to shape and mold us into the unique, gifted, and valuable individuals He has called us to be. In Christ, we never have any reason to feel defeated or afraid.
